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1418331 96 26463027949
713983652 7435286 353699
713983652 7435286 353699
71568949 955 69559126 448 05
All about undefined
Interested in learning more?
713983652 7435286 353699
71568949 955 69559126 448 05
See more
30867383542 963
277416 072008505 87694528260
See more
66769 7024 57
792384144 8485 54 5110553
See more